### Some Important Notes:
|
### Some Important Notes: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
- Vector/Matrix:
|
- Vector/Matrix:
|
||||||
+ GTSAM expects double-precision floating point vectors and matrices.
|
|
||||||
|
- GTSAM expects double-precision floating point vectors and matrices.
|
||||||
Hence, you should pass numpy matrices with `dtype=float`, or `float64`.
|
Hence, you should pass numpy matrices with `dtype=float`, or `float64`.
|
||||||
+ Also, GTSAM expects *column-major* matrices, unlike the default storage
|
- Also, GTSAM expects _column-major_ matrices, unlike the default storage
|
||||||
scheme in numpy. Hence, you should pass column-major matrices to gtsam using
|
scheme in numpy. Hence, you should pass column-major matrices to GTSAM using
|
||||||
the flag order='F'. And you always get column-major matrices back.
|
the flag order='F'. And you always get column-major matrices back.
|
||||||
For more details, see [this link](https://github.com/wouterboomsma/eigency#storage-layout---why-arrays-are-sometimes-transposed).
|
For more details, see [this link](https://github.com/wouterboomsma/eigency#storage-layout---why-arrays-are-sometimes-transposed).
|
||||||
+ Passing row-major matrices of different dtype, e.g. `int`, will also work
|
- Passing row-major matrices of different dtype, e.g. `int`, will also work
|
||||||
as the wrapper converts them to column-major and dtype float for you,
|
as the wrapper converts them to column-major and dtype float for you,
|
||||||
using numpy.array.astype(float, order='F', copy=False).
|
using numpy.array.astype(float, order='F', copy=False).
|
||||||
However, this will result a copy if your matrix is not in the expected type
|
However, this will result a copy if your matrix is not in the expected type
|
||||||
and storage order.
|
and storage order.
